What steps can individuals take to protect their investments in the event of a total collapse of cryptocurrencies?

- IT-Forensics2Sep 12, 2021 · 5 years agoOne possible step individuals can take to protect their investments in the event of a total collapse of cryptocurrencies is to diversify their portfolio. By spreading their investments across different asset classes, such as stocks, bonds, and real estate, individuals can reduce the risk of losing everything if cryptocurrencies were to fail. This strategy allows them to have a fallback plan and potentially recover some of their losses. Additionally, individuals can consider investing in stable and reliable cryptocurrencies that have a proven track record and are less likely to collapse. Doing thorough research and consulting with financial advisors can help individuals make informed decisions and minimize the impact of a potential collapse.

- Korn0020Apr 16, 2024 · 2 years agoWhen faced with the possibility of a total collapse of cryptocurrencies, individuals should consider taking a more conservative approach to their investments. This could involve reducing exposure to highly volatile cryptocurrencies and focusing on more stable assets, such as blue-chip stocks or government bonds. Additionally, individuals can explore alternative investment options, such as precious metals like gold or silver, which have historically served as safe-haven assets during times of economic uncertainty. It's crucial to consult with financial professionals and conduct thorough research before making any investment decisions.
